Comparative analysis of the images of the actual and probabilistic future families was conducted in order to study the peculiarities of formation of family models in children (senior preschool age). Data was collected using a combination of two research method, i.e., focus group method and family drawing projective technique. The reasons for selection of qualitative research methods in sociology were the following: psychological specifics of childhood, close determination of an evolving mind and childrens relations with the lifeworld and social space. The research has shown differences in the actual and future family models as viewed by children with a trend for their transformation.
